Android P moves the CALL_LOG, READ_CALL_LOG, WRITE_CALL_LOG, and PROCESS_OUTGOING_CALLS permissions from the PHONE permission group to the new CALL_LOG permission group. This group gives users better control and visibility to apps that need access to sensitive information about phone calls, such as reading phone call records and identifying phone numbers.
Restricted access to phone numbers
Apps running on Android P can no longer read phone numbers or phone state without first acquiring the READ_CALL_LOG permission, in addition to the other permissions that your app’s use cases require.
Phone numbers associated with incoming and outgoing calls are visible in the phone state broadcast, such as for incoming and outgoing calls, and are accessible from the PhoneStateListener class. Without the READ_CALL_LOG permission, the phone number field that’s provided in PHONE_STATE_CHANGED broadcasts and through PhoneStateListener is empty.
To read phone numbers from phone state, update your app to request the necessary permissions based on your use case:
To read numbers from the PHONE_STATE intent action, you need both the READ_CALL_LOG permission and the READ_PHONE_STATE permission.
To read numbers from onCallStateChanged(), you now need the READ_CALL_LOG permission only. You no longer need the READ_PHONE_STATE permission.
